FEASEL OBITUARIES, Henry County, Missouri ==================================================================== FEASEL, Fay Arthur 1905 - 1995 Fay Arthur Feasel was born February 23, 1905, near Kingsville, and died December 5, 1995, at Golden Valley Memorial Hospital in Clinton. He was the son of William Arthur Feasel and Emma Elizabeth Morris Feasel. The family lived on the farm that had been homesteaded by his Grandfather Feasel until 1911 when they moved to Kingsville and owned a drugstore until 1913 when they returned to the farm. When Fay was 20 years old, he began operating a garage in Kingsville in partnership with his brother. A few years later, he returned to the farm. On June 8, 1930, Fay married Myra Elizabeth Stephenson from Shawnee Mound. Their first home was on the Feasel Farm. Then they moved in late 1931 to the farm west of Shawnee Mound and lived with Myra's parents. Except for a short period of time when he lived in the Deer Creek community, Fay lived at Shawnee Mound until 1990 when his health no longer permitted him to live alone. Since that time he has made his home with his daughters and their husbands, Doris and Kenneth Hunter an Shirley and Paul Farnsworth. As a young man, Fay accepted Christ as his Savior and was baptized and became a member of the Christian Church in Kingsville. Later his membership was moved to the Shawnee Mound Cumberland Presbyterian Church were he served as a deacon and later as an elder. He was active in community concerns serving on the local school board and being a charter member of the Henry County Farm Bureau. He was also a charter member of Gideon's International Clinton Camp and helped with the distribution of scriptures as long as he was able. Along with being a farmer, Fay did Soil Conservation Construction work building many ponds, terraces and silos and clearing brush and hedge rows in Johnson and Henry counties. One of his greatest loves was driving the bulldozer or grader to help preserve the land for future generations. FEASEL, Myra Elizabeth STEPHENSON 1903 - 1982 Myra Elizabeth Feasel was born December 30, 1903 at Deepwater, the daughter of Louis Clifton and Eliza Ann Stephenson. She died January 4, 1982 at Golden Valley Hospital at the age of 78 years and five days. When she was five years old, the family moved to the William Hinton farm in the Shawnee Mound community, where she still resided. She attended Shawnee Mound School, graduating in the first high school graduating class in 1923. In 1930, she was united in marriage to Fay A. Feasel of Kingsville, MO. Their wedding was the second wedding in the Shawnee Mound Cumberland Presbyterian Church. They celebrated their 50th wedding anniversary June 8, 1980 at the church. Mrs. Feasel was a school teacher for many years and retired from the Leeton School system. She is survived by her husband, Fay A.
